What is the difference between Deposit Operations Processor vs Deposit Clerk?

AspectDeposit Operations ProcessorDeposit Clerk
CredentialsHigh school diploma; some roles may require banking certificationsHigh school diploma or equivalent
Work EnvironmentBank back-office, processing transactions and dataBank branch, customer service area
Employer & Industry UsageFinancial institutions, banksBank branches, credit unions
Primary ResponsibilitiesProcessing deposits, verifying transactions, data entryAssisting customers, handling deposits and withdrawals

The Deposit Operations Processor primarily handles back-office transaction processing and data verification, while the Deposit Clerk interacts directly with customers at the branch, focusing on deposit and withdrawal services. Both roles are essential in banking operations but differ in responsibilities and work environment.

What is a deposit operations processor?

Deposit Operations Processors are banking professionals responsible for handling and processing various financial transactions related to customer deposit accounts, such as checking and savings accounts. They ensure the accuracy and timeliness of deposits, withdrawals, account transfers, and other related transactions. Their role often involves reconciling balances, resolving discrepancies, maintaining compliance with banking regulations, and providing support to both internal teams and customers. Attention to detail and strong organizational skills are essential in this position to prevent errors and maintain the integrity of financial records.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a deposit operations processor?

To thrive as a Deposit Operations Processor, you need a strong attention to detail, understanding of banking procedures, and familiarity with compliance regulations, typically supported by a high school diploma or relevant experience. Proficiency with banking software, document imaging systems, and Microsoft Office applications is usually required. Strong organizational skills, teamwork, and effective communication help you excel in managing high volumes of transactions and resolving discrepancies. These skills are crucial for ensuring accurate processing, regulatory compliance, and maintaining the integrity of financial operations.

Job Description

The Retail Compliance and QC Analyst will establish and monitor deposit compliance and quality control processes, including first line of defense management to ensure regulatory compliance and effective risk management. In addition, they will track laws and regulations ensuring the Retail business unit complies with federal, state, and local regulatory requirements that might affect the organization's policies.

Duties and Responsibilities include the following.

Retail Compliance

  • Monitor the impact of new regulations or changes to existing regulations, and general compliance issues and concerns.
  • Monitor advancements in information technologies to ensure departmental adaptation and compliance.
  • Oversee and coordinate efforts to monitor and maintain compliance with all federal and state regulations.
  • Establish and maintain Risk and Controls Self-Assessment (RCSA) and compliance-centric Key Risk Indicators (KRI) and Key Performance Indicators (KPI) to assess performance and identify potential risk.
  • Ensure retail compliance objectives are met and activities related to standards and legal regulations are tracked and identified.
  • Establish and maintain operating procedures and processes, including first line of defense management monitoring.
  • Collaborate with Regional Operations Managers to facilitate compliance meetings to identify both existing and emerging risks and implement changes in controls to mitigate those risks.
  • Collaborate with key stakeholders within the Compliance Team, Internal Audit Team and Operational Risk Team.
  • Provide compliance guidance to and answer questions from retail staff on federal and state regulations including FinCEN, BSA, FCRA, FDIC, OFAC, Reg CC, Reg DD, Reg E, Reg V, UDAP, privacy laws, Dodd-Frank and other consumer related laws and regulations.
  • Collect and disseminate information related to compliance and other relevant subjects.
  • Perform re-test of findings due to an internal or external retail audit.
  • Provide assistance at all levels of operations as needed to complete projects on time and stay in compliance with Origin Bank policies and regulatory requirements.
  • Work with the Core Support and Deposit Operations teams to test and document all new policy and procedure releases on the Deposit Origination platform.

Quality Control

  • Collaborate with vendors and partners to ensure timely and accurately prepared reports and findings.
  • Work with management team and department managers to ensure findings and/or deficiencies are addressed and corrected.
  • Oversee first line of defense management monitoring.
  • Test Risk and Controls Self-Assessments (RCSA) and Key Risk Indicators (KRI) and Key Performance Indicators (KPI) to assess performance and identify potential risks.
  • Maintain knowledge of deposit account requirements and Origin Bank policies and procedures.
  • Compile, distribute, and present monthly management reports based on review of findings.
  • Report unresolved critical deficiencies to appropriate management.
  • Recommend quality operational improvements based on review of findings.
  • Review deposit account and compliance exceptions to determine QC selections.
  • Determine QC trends and challenges and implement resolutions as required.
  • Coach bankers on QC trends and challenges.
